The Hollowmere units recalibrate humidity sensors nightly at 02:00 local. Drift beyond ±4% between calibrations pages on-call. First response: check `driftd` logs, confirm the reference probe is reporting, then trigger a manual recalibration via the admin CLI. Do not restart the controller mid-cycle; it discards the calibration baseline. Escalate to the firmware channel if drift persists across two cycles. The CLI authenticates to the controller fleet using a token your env file must define on the next line.

secret setting of hawep-yahig: LEDGER_TOKEN29=41b5d6315371c92885eaeb077fb63

Onboarding note for reviewers on Parcelwing: the tracking webhook fires on every carrier scan event and retries with exponential backoff up to six attempts. Review checklist: idempotency key handling, signature verification, and dead-letter routing. Staging secrets rotate weekly. Should you need to re-arm the webhook sandbox after a rotation, the recovery passphrase below will get you back in.

vault phrase of tajef-tafog = istox-sorax-zorox-casok-holox-kelix-weneth-drueth-casion

## Break-Glass Access: Relevance Tuning Console

The Querrel relevance console at Vantiq Labs is read-only in normal operation. Emergency boost-weight changes (e.g., a runaway synonym rule degrading results) require break-glass entry, logged and reviewed within 24 hours. Only the on-duty search lead may initiate. To unseal the tuning console during an incident, enter the recovery passphrase shown below.

vault phrase of taweg-kafof = oliax-zorael

- [ ] **Step 7: Breaker override escrow.** After sealing the signing keys for the Tallgrove upstream API circuit breaker, confirm the support team can force the breaker open during a full outage. The override bundle lives in the sealed escrow drawer and is useless without its unlock phrase. Two ceremony witnesses must initial this step before proceeding. The escrow bundle is decrypted with the recovery passphrase that follows.

vault phrase of kahip-kahop = holath-quenmir